Output 36bb66c2126191d4fd1d8aa2ef1758e5864a03172d9aca1cd0147426f6c319e6:41

value
562239
script pubkey
OP_0 OP_PUSHBYTES_20 55695d28e03de640729cc880d0bad5515e80cc94
address
bc1q2454628q8hnyqu5uezqdpwk4290gpny5cwhjh0
transaction
36bb66c2126191d4fd1d8aa2ef1758e5864a03172d9aca1cd0147426f6c319e6
confirmations
282138
spent
true